ABS coach Henry Makinwa declares war against former NPFL champions Kano Pillars

Date: 2017-06-26

Head coach of Abubakar Bukola Saraki Football Club (ABS FC) Henry Makinwa has confirmed his wards' readiness for their next anticipated clash against former NPFL champions Kano Pillars.

The Saraki Boys will face the Sai Masugida in their Nigeria Professional Football League (NPFL) week 26 duel on Wednesday, June 28, 2017 at the Kwara state Stadium, Ilorin.

Makinwa who has represented 17 clubs in 11 countries during his professional career told NAIJ.com that Kano Pillars will face the consequence of his boys' defeat at Shooting Stars of Ibadan in their last game.

''Yes, we are ready for Kano Pillars even though I know the match will be tough for my players considering the pedigree of our opponents who are former champions. ''But I have a young squad that can deliver the work for me on Wednesday, and I want all Kwara people to come out and support us to victory against Kano Pillars,'' Makinwa explained.

ABS FC of Ilorin currently occupy 12th position on the Nigeria Professional Football League standings with 34 points, and Makinwa who is of Spanish descent believes that the Saraki Boys can still finish among the top four teams.

''My target this season is to pick a continental ticket with my young squad, and when you look at the table, you will want to agree with me that it is possible for us to achieve our aim at the end of the season,'' he stated.
